Worked an all-day tournament to do a favor for a friend, and to make a little extra money. We drove all in one car (an hour!) and of course, we arrived with very little prep time. I dashed onto my floor (where I would be working alone all day), talked briefly with the table people...

and then realized that my morning coffee was collecting itself in preparation for a fast exit. I ran to the rest room, quickly took care of things, and ran back. As I stepped in the door of the gym, I heard a whistle and saw that they had already started playing without me! The way this tournament ran was for all the floors to start together each rotation -- and I'd missed it, not having been in the pre-game.

The players were setting up for free throws at the far end as I ran across the floor. A player tried to pass me the ball, but it wasn't a good throw and it hit my toes and bounced up to my knees as I bent over to get it. For some reason, I felt I needed to avoid kicking the ball, so I stopped running -- well, my feet stopped, but unfortunately the rest of me didn't, and as I bent over to pick up the ball my momentum carried me on down to the floor.

I lay there for a few seconds trying to decide whether to fake a serious injury so I might get out with some shred of dignity left. In the end I just figured I'd have to be good enough to live down this little incident. i don't know whether I pulled it off or not.

What a way to start a Saturday! (I never did figure out who blew the whistle for the first foul!)
